  The next day I battered up crappie and catfish for a fish fry-I did allot of fish-everyone loved it-the new batter recipe I use now every one loves that tries it I had so much left over that I searched online if I could freeze it and one can. So I just need to heat up some in the oven. This is the recipe for the batter.    For the flour I use Bobs red mill 1-1 gluten free flour, for the corn flour I use his gluten free corn flour, and for the beer I use gluten free beer or seltzer water. I used seltzer water this time and the batter was perfect. The seltzer water is a better choice over club soda if you are watching salt intake.
